Strongly agree
Yes
Progressives generally support increasing taxes on the wealthy, including capital gains taxes. They believe that this can help reduce income inequality and fund social programs. However, this score is not a 5 because some progressives may have more specific preferences on how to increase these taxes. Strongly disagree
No, increasing the capital gains tax will limit investment in our economy
Progressives generally disagree with the argument that increasing capital gains taxes will limit investment in the economy. They believe that the wealthy can afford to pay higher taxes without significantly impacting their investment behavior. Very strongly disagree
No, and abolish capital gains taxes
Abolishing capital gains taxes is strongly opposed by progressives, as it would disproportionately benefit the wealthy and reduce government revenue needed for social programs. This position is fundamentally at odds with the progressive goal of reducing income inequality through taxation.
